Protein is a fundamental component of every cell in your body, acting as a crucial building block for tissues, hormones, and enzymes. Removing it from your diet, even for a short period, forces your body to find alternative sources for these building blocks, leading to a cascade of immediate and long-term health complications.

The Immediate Effects: What Happens First?

When you first stop eating protein, your body uses its existing reserves to maintain critical functions. This depletion of reserves leads to several noticeable effects within days or weeks.

  • Fatigue and Weakness: Protein is a source of energy, and its absence leaves you feeling unusually tired and weak, both mentally and physically.
  • Increased Hunger and Cravings: Protein is highly satiating. Without it, you may experience constant hunger and intense cravings for sugary and high-carb foods to compensate for the lack of fullness.
  • Brain Fog and Mood Swings: Amino acids from protein are needed to produce neurotransmitters like serotonin and dopamine, which regulate mood and focus. A deficiency can lead to irritability, poor concentration, and symptoms of depression.
  • Slow Wound Healing: Protein is essential for tissue repair and growth. Small cuts and scrapes that would normally heal quickly will take much longer to recover.

The Long-Term Fallout: Systemic Breakdown

If protein deprivation continues, the consequences become more severe and affect multiple bodily systems.

Muscle Wasting and Strength Loss

Your muscles are your body's largest protein reservoir. When you don't consume enough dietary protein, your body starts breaking down muscle tissue for energy and amino acids to sustain more vital functions. This involuntary muscle breakdown, or sarcopenia, leads to a significant loss of muscle mass, decreased strength, and poorer physical performance, especially in older adults.

A Compromised Immune System

Protein is critical for building antibodies, which are a cornerstone of the immune system. A lack of protein impairs the body's ability to fight off infections from bacteria and viruses. This leaves you vulnerable to frequent and more severe illnesses, such as respiratory tract infections and gastroenteritis.

Edema: Swelling from Fluid Imbalance

One of the classic signs of severe protein deficiency is edema, a condition characterized by swollen and puffy skin, particularly in the abdomen, legs, and feet. This occurs because proteins like albumin, which circulate in the blood, help maintain the balance of fluids in the body. When protein levels drop, fluid leaks into surrounding tissues, causing swelling.

Impact on Hair, Skin, and Nails

Your hair, skin, and nails are largely made of structural proteins like keratin, collagen, and elastin. A protein-deficient diet can cause these tissues to deteriorate. Symptoms include brittle and thinning hair, dry and flaky skin, and deep ridges forming on the fingernails.

The Severe Consequences: Kwashiorkor and Fatty Liver

In extreme cases of protein-energy malnutrition, particularly in children in developing nations, life-threatening conditions can develop. Kwashiorkor is a type of malnutrition where a person consumes enough calories but not enough protein. It is characterized by severe edema and distended belly, sparse hair, and stunted growth.

Another severe outcome is fatty liver disease, which can result from a lack of fat-transporting proteins (lipoproteins). This leads to fat accumulation in liver cells, which can cause inflammation, scarring, and potential liver failure.

How to Ensure Adequate Protein Intake

Since stopping protein is not a viable health strategy, the focus should be on meeting your daily needs, which vary based on age, gender, and activity level. A registered dietitian can help you develop a personalized plan if you are concerned about your intake, and for a deep dive on sources, you can review resources like the Harvard T.H. Chan School of Public Health's guide to protein sources.

Here are some excellent sources of protein to include in your diet:

  • Animal-Based: Lean meats (chicken, beef), fish (salmon, tuna), eggs, and dairy products (Greek yogurt, cottage cheese).
  • Plant-Based: Legumes (lentils, beans, chickpeas), nuts and seeds (almonds, chia seeds), and soy products (tofu, tempeh).
